try rpm -qi orbit instead of capitalising
When I run into similar reports I also sudo updatedb
locate abc
whereis abc
ls -aFl /sbin abc and search throught /sbin, /usr/bin, /usr/sbin and any 
other directory
and yumlist abc, just in case.
